Need advice about which tool to choose?Ask the StackShare community!

KeePassXC

42
55
+ 1
26
LastPass

313
312
+ 1
72
Add tool

KeePassXC vs LastPass: What are the differences?

Introduction

KeePassXC and LastPass are both popular password managers that offer users a secure way to store and manage their passwords. While they have similar functionalities, there are key differences between the two that make each of them unique. In this article, we will explore these differences in detail.

  1. Account Ownership: One key difference between KeePassXC and LastPass is the ownership of user accounts. KeePassXC is a self-hosted password manager, which means that users have complete control over their own data. They can choose where to store their password database and are solely responsible for its security. On the other hand, LastPass is a cloud-based password manager, where the user's data is stored on LastPass servers. This offers the convenience of accessing passwords from anywhere, but it also means that users have to trust LastPass with the security of their data.

  2. Browser Integration: Another significant difference between KeePassXC and LastPass is browser integration. KeePassXC requires a browser extension to be installed in order to fill passwords automatically on websites. This extension communicates directly with the KeePassXC application and ensures a secure password autofill experience. In contrast, LastPass has native browser integration, eliminating the need for a separate extension. With LastPass, passwords are autofilled directly in the browser without the need for any additional setup.

  3. User Interface: The user interface is a notable difference between KeePassXC and LastPass. KeePassXC has a simple and minimalistic interface, focused on functionality rather than aesthetics. It provides a straightforward experience for users who prefer a no-frills approach. On the other hand, LastPass has a more modern and polished user interface, with a visually appealing design and additional features like password generation and secure notes.

  4. Security Model: The security model is an essential aspect to consider when comparing KeePassXC and LastPass. KeePassXC relies on a local, encrypted password database that is stored on the user's device. This ensures that the data remains under the user's control and is not accessible remotely. On the contrary, LastPass employs a cloud-based approach, where the encrypted password database is stored on LastPass servers. While this allows for easy synchronization between devices, it introduces an additional layer of trust in the security of the cloud service.

  5. Multi-Platform Support: KeePassXC and LastPass differ in terms of multi-platform support. KeePassXC is a cross-platform password manager and is available on various operating systems, including Windows, macOS, and Linux. It provides consistent functionality and user experience across different platforms. In contrast, LastPass offers broader multi-platform support, including mobile platforms like iOS and Android, making it more versatile for users who need password access on multiple devices.

  6. Pricing Model: Last but not least, the pricing model is an important distinction between KeePassXC and LastPass. KeePassXC is a free and open-source software, available to all users at no cost. It contributes to the appeal of self-hosted solutions and provides full access to all features without any limitations. On the other hand, LastPass offers both a free version and a premium version with a subscription fee. The premium version unlocks additional features, such as priority support and family password sharing.

In summary, KeePassXC and LastPass differ in account ownership, browser integration, user interface, security model, multi-platform support, and pricing model. KeePassXC puts the control in the hands of the user, while LastPass offers the convenience of a cloud-based solution. Ultimately, the choice between the two depends on individual preferences and security concerns.

Get Advice from developers at your company using StackShare Enterprise. Sign up for StackShare Enterprise.
Learn More
Pros of KeePassXC
Pros of LastPass
  • 8
    Free
  • 4
    Password Generator
  • 4
    Open source
  • 3
    Import & Export
  • 3
    Plugings
  • 3
    Password stored encrypted
  • 1
    Chrome plugin
  • 19
    Synchronised across browsers
  • 16
    Chrome plugin
  • 14
    Passwords stored encrpyted
  • 8
    All devices
  • 8
    Central servers do not have keys
  • 2
    Better then lesspass
  • 2
    The most cost-effective b/t Roboform and 1Password
  • 2
    company wide
  • 1
    Free plan

Sign up to add or upvote prosMake informed product decisions

Cons of KeePassXC
Cons of LastPass
  • 0
    Free
  • 3
    Slow, unpredictable sync when sharing passwords
  • 3
    UI for admins is an inconsistent mess
  • 2
    Paid
  • 1
    Buggy Chrome add-on
  • 1
    Cannot edit shared password

Sign up to add or upvote consMake informed product decisions

- No public GitHub repository available -

What is KeePassXC?

It is a cross-platform community-driven port of the Windows application “Keepass Password Safe”. It can store your passwords safely and auto-type them into your everyday websites and applications.

What is LastPass?

LastPass Enterprise offers your employees and admins a single, unified experience that combines the power of SAML SSO coupled with enterprise-class password vaulting. LastPass is your first line of defense in the battle to protect your digital assets from the significant risks associated with employee password re-use and phishing.

Need advice about which tool to choose?Ask the StackShare community!

What companies use KeePassXC?
What companies use LastPass?
See which teams inside your own company are using KeePassXC or LastPass.
Sign up for StackShare EnterpriseLearn More

Sign up to get full access to all the companiesMake informed product decisions

What tools integrate with KeePassXC?
What tools integrate with LastPass?

Sign up to get full access to all the tool integrationsMake informed product decisions

What are some alternatives to KeePassXC and LastPass?
KeePass
It is an open source password manager. Passwords can be stored in highly-encrypted databases, which can be unlocked with one master password or key file.
bitwarden
bitwarden is the easiest and safest way to store and sync your passwords across all of your devices.
KeeWeb
It is a free cross-platform password manager compatible with KeePass. It tries to address this issue by providing KeePass users with options to create a self-hosted version of KeePass on the Internet.
1Password
Lock credentials and secrets in vaults that sync across systems and seamlessly access within your dev, CI/CD, and production environments. Plus, generate and use SSH keys directly from 1Password, automate infrastructure secrets, and more.
Password Safe
It is a password database utility. Like many other such products, commercial and otherwise, it stores your passwords in an encrypted file, allowing you to remember only one password (the "safe combination").
See all alternatives